"Town Hall, Birmingham, after the Lloyd George meeting, Dec. 18th 1901": postcard showing the smashed windows of Birmingham Town Hall after a mob attacked an anti-war meeting held there during the Boer War. One man was killed during the Victoria Square riot and David Lloyd George, the key speaker, had to be smuggled out wearing a policeman's uniform to reduce the danger to his life
